Transaction 39177738d64e65aed1b3c5d1a052c3acb4b61fdca79efff6830ac7903cce2666

1 Input
2 Outputs
  • 39177738d64e65aed1b3c5d1a052c3acb4b61fdca79efff6830ac7903cce2666:0
  • value  68769904
    address  bc1qagph4k5fvy79lkgv98hu4l56mre569fnmuexuw
  • 39177738d64e65aed1b3c5d1a052c3acb4b61fdca79efff6830ac7903cce2666:1
  • value  7100000
    address  3FvtXub1rvFerLUxnNqSEGhsgvMEokTSgz